Ms. Shirley (Shirley Raines), the TikTok creator and homeless advocate behind the nonprofit Beauty 2 The Streetz, has recently died at the age of 58, and her organization has publicly confirmed her passing.

Who Ms. Shirley Was

  • She was the founder and CEO of Beauty 2 The Streetz, a nonprofit that provides meals, hygiene items, and beauty services (makeup, hair, lashes) to unhoused people, especially on Skid Row in Los Angeles.
  • She built a large following on TikTok and other platforms (millions of followers) by sharing her outreach work and personal interactions with people living on the streets.
  • She was widely recognized and honored, including being named CNN Hero of the Year 2021 and highlighted in later creator/impact lists for her community work.

Many fans knew her from her warm “Hi, how you doing, baby?” style greetings and the way she tried to restore dignity through self-care and respect rather than just handouts.

What Happened to Her

  • She was found unresponsive at her home in Nevada (Las Vegas area) during a wellness check in late January 2026.
  • Reports state that she died in her sleep; family members and her nonprofit have said that no foul play is suspected, and an autopsy was pending or not yet fully disclosed at the time of the latest reports.
  • As of now, there is no publicly confirmed detailed cause of death; coverage consistently mentions that the exact cause has not yet been announced or remains under investigation.

Because there is no official cause released, anything beyond this (for example, speculation about health issues, substances, or specific medical events) is just rumor and should be treated cautiously.

What Happens to Beauty 2 The Streetz Now

  • Her nonprofit has publicly stated that they plan to continue her mission and keep services running for the Skid Row and Nevada communities she served.
  • A GoFundMe that originally started to support and expand the outreach has seen a surge in donations since her passing, as supporters rally to keep her work going.
  • The board and team are expected to decide on new long‑term leadership, but their messaging emphasizes honoring her legacy rather than shutting down operations.

Context: Why Her Story Resonates

  • Ms. Shirley’s work stood out because she emphasized dignity and beauty—offering hair coloring, makeup, and pampering alongside food and supplies, which helped people feel seen and human, not just “served.”
  • Her own past included serious hardship and loss, which she shared openly and which motivated her to show up for people society often ignores.
  • In the broader 2020s trend of mutual aid and social justice content online, she became a powerful example of using a social media platform to drive real‑world, face‑to‑face community care.
